About this listen

Previously part of a collection, this rare Ellery Queen mystery is available as a standalone audiobook for the first time.

In "The Honest Swindler", Ellery is challenged to solve an imaginary riddle devised by three members of the Puzzle Club. He must explain how an old prospector could have spent five years on a fruitless uranium hunt and still have returned every penny of his backers' money.

©1971 Ellery Queen (P)2016 Blackstone Audio, Inc.
